Timezone in Cuijk
Cuijk is located in the Europe/Amsterdam timezone, which operates on Central European Time (CET) with a UTC offset of +1 hour. During daylight saving time, which runs from the last Sunday in March to the last Sunday in October, the timezone shifts to Central European Summer Time (CEST) with a UTC offset of +2 hours. This means that in the summer months, the clocks are set forward one hour, providing more daylight in the evenings.
When considering the time difference between Cuijk and various locations in the United States, it is essential to note that Cuijk is typically 6 to 9 hours ahead, depending on whether the U.S. location observes daylight saving time. Practical Information for Visitors
Cuijk is conveniently accessible via public transport. The nearest major airport is Eindhoven Airport, approximately 30 kilometers away, which offers various international flights. Visitors can take a train to Cuijk from nearby cities like Nijmegen or Venray, with a direct connection that makes travel straightforward.
Local buses also run frequently, providing easy transport within the region. The climate in Cuijk is typically maritime temperate, characterized by mild summers and cool winters. The average temperature in summer ranges from 20 to 25 degrees Celsius, while winter temperatures can drop to around 0 degrees Celsius.
